That's a question that can't be answered unless you take the time to analyze every team's draft for a decade. But in the Chiefs case, James O'Shaugnessy and DJ Alexander made the team in 2015, Aaron Murray in 2014 and Sanders Commings in 2013, although he never saw the field due to injury.
But there are notable 5th rounders across the league such as Richard Sherman.
The bottom line is that there's barely any risk involved in taking a 5th rounder, especially when the team had two early 4th rounders and two 5th rounders.
